On the basis of games I have seen so far, my guess is that Hiarcs 9.6 is about 30-40 ELO stronger than 9.0 I am currently playing a match: Hiarcs 9.6 on 1.25GHz G4 eMac v Gandalf 6 on 1.6GHz Centrino On comparing the nps on the G4 and the Centrino for Hiarcs, Deep Sjeng, Ruffian-2 and Fruit-2 I reckon the Centrino is on average about 2.4x faster than the G4 for chess calculation. This gives Gandalf a rating boost (conservatively) of 40 ELO by playing on the faster machine. Despite this, Hiarcs 9 is currently winning: Program Score % Av.Op. Elo + - Draws 1 Hiarcs : 19.0/ 35 54.3 2585 2615 117 82 40.0 % 2 Gandalf : 16.0/ 35 45.7 2615 2585 82 117 40.0 % If you go by the CSS Rating list http://www.computerschach.de/magazin/rangliste_english/ this would give Hiarcs 9.6 a rating around 2725 (note that H9.0 LOST its individual match v Gandalf on equal hardware in that rating list) Hiarcs stunning performances against Ruffian and Deep Sjeng on the Mac are in the same ballpark, or better - I think a guess of CSS 2725 is fairly conservative. On SSDF rating list Gandalf and Hiarcs are about equal on equal hardware, so here the results would suggest a leap of >50 points - but SSDF are classic chess games not blitz, Hiarcs is a better blitzer than classic engine, and I have been measuring mostly blitz performance. I know that this is all speculation, the number of games are still few, and error bars are large, but it is fun to speculate, and life is short!
